At a fundamental level DIY cinder block fire pit is a simple hole filled with gravel and surrounded by a few rows of boulders. The wall thickness must be about 20-30 cm, but not less than 10 cm. The size of your hearth depends on your desire. Make a marking out of a necessary size, depth and shape, and dig a trench for the foundation. Then build a wall of a desired height, but not much than 1 m. If you are interested in these ideas, search after more detailed information and make you own fireplace.
